In my case, I had a teemo trolling my lane. I'm sure we can all relate. I blew up at him. I'd had some instances with toxic behavior before and I realized as soon as I finished blowing up that I'd said a few things that weren't either sportsmanlike or humanitarian. I have been through a lot recently, and it's no excuse for my behavior. Lots of changes in my life stressing me out. So what is my point here? Playing league, as fun as it usually is, when you're already stressing, is a great way to accidentally let your life stress spill over on others. Which makes for a very unpleasant experience for ten people. Tilting and feeding and building statikk shiv and guinsoo on Anivia is not the solution. Cussing out the Teemo isn't the solution either. It's probably in your best interest not to play while stressed, and even if you're not, flaming gets you nowhere. Your account goes on a one way trip to the void, and all your work goes down the drain. Saying things and then apologizing isn't the solution either. Best to keep your mouth shut and not say things you will regret later. I sure as hell regret every last toxic thing I've ever said.
